After enjoying each other’s company and some snacks, it was time to find out if Chelsea and Nate were having a boy or girl.  We were each given a can of silly string with a gray label so we had no idea what color the silly string would be.  On the count of three Chelsea and Nate turned around and we sprayed them with the silly string to announce what gender baby they were having.
